Amazon's AI Chips: Trainium Series

At the heart of Amazon's AI strategy is its custom Trainium chip series. The Trainium2, for instance, offers a compelling 30% to 40% better price performance compared to other GPU-based instances, making it an attractive option for businesses looking to scale their AI operations without breaking the bank[2]. Furthermore, Amazon is set to release the Trainium3 chip, which promises to be up to twice as fast as its predecessor while offering 40% better energy efficiency[4]. This next-generation chip is expected to be fabricated with 3nm technology and will likely be produced by TSMC[4].

Pricing Strategy: A Challenge to Nvidia

Amazon's aggressive pricing strategy is perhaps the most significant challenge to Nvidia's dominance. By slashing the prices of its Trainium AI chips to offer similar performance at just 25% of the cost of Nvidia's H100 chips, Amazon is making a bold play to lure customers away[5]. This move is not just about undercutting Nvidia but also about creating a more accessible AI ecosystem for businesses and developers.

Real-World Applications and Impacts

Amazon's AI chips are not just theoretical; they are being integrated into real-world applications. For example, Amazon's Bedrock service allows customers to build high-quality generative AI applications using models like Anthropic's Claude and Meta's Llama[2]. This managed service simplifies the process of developing AI applications, making it more accessible to businesses without extensive AI expertise.
